Xavi Out Of Barcelona's Champions League Clash With VfB Stuttgart

F.C Barcelona‘s injury headache has returned ahead of their crucial second leg clash with VfB Stuttgart in the Champions League last 16.

According to El Mundo Deportivo, influential playmaker Xavi has been ruled out of the tie against the German outfit after picking up a thigh injury during training on Tuesday.

The club have yet to confirm the injury but it is suspected that the 30-year-old could be out of action for around 10 to 15 days.

Coach Pep Guardiola will now have to decide how to line up his midfield against Stuttgart as Seydou Keita has yet to be confirmed fully fit at the end of Tuesday’s workout session eventhough he managed to train with the rest of the squad.

Barcelona and Stuttgart are locked at 1-1 after the first leg encounter in Germany three weeks ago.
